The produced water treatment market can be broken down into onshore and offshore subsegments depending on where the water is actually being treated. The market for treating generated water can be broken down into several subsets according on the various technologies used. Adsorption, cyclones, and improved floating are all physical methods of therapy.
Polymeric membranes, inorganic membranes, microfiltration/ultrafiltration, reverse osmosis, and nanofiltration are all examples of membrane treatment. Some examples of thermal technologies are simple evaporation, multistage flash distillation, multieffect distillation, vapour compression distillation, freeze/thaw evaporation, and a combination of the two. Chemical precipitation, electrochemical procedures, demulsifiers, oxidation, and other similar methods are all examples of chemical treatment processes.
Produced water is a byproduct of oil and gas extraction and consists of both organic and inorganic compounds. The acidic nature of the produced water need treatment before it can be released into rivers or used for re-injection at oil and gas wells.The ever-increasing population of the world has resulted in a dramatic rise in the consumption of freshwater. The prolonged release of water containing oil pollutes the environment and depletes resources. This will likely cause a shortage of fresh water in the near future. Discharge criteria regulating oil concentration levels in discharged streams have been imposed by the governments of numerous nations in an effort to regulate environmental practises.Oil and gas are buoyed upward by water, making it easier for them to reach the surface. In order to maximise oil and gas extraction efficiency, produced water must be processed and reused. As oil and gas production has increased, stricter regulations have been put in place to limit the direct release of produced water, leading to the development of new water treatment techniques.Produced water treatment is in high demand in regions where freshwater is scarce. Companies in the produced water treatment market are capitalising on growth potential in membrane treatment in addition to traditional chemical and biological treatments. The membrane bioreactor, which combines a submerged hollow fibre with procedures like microfiltration or ultrafiltration in an activated sludge process, is being used by the Singaporean scale-up Ceraflo to treat generated water for the oil and gas industry. The use of bioreactors for the biological treatment of wastewater is becoming increasingly common. In order to improve the effluent quality, businesses in the produced water treatment market are turning to membrane bioreactors for efficient removal of total petroleum hydrocarbons (TPH) from generated water. The research and development of PTFE hollow-fiber membrane systems for treating generated water is accelerating.
